Output 528186ae7a2566f32542ed9473d44ad168d2791574214330dcdc3aa9beee11c0:0

value
599599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d30a1eeb8682dd8b8d78ef636e1e708d22a299 OP_EQUAL
address
3KubD14hM8ZnkjgztNKsBh7zbkDpTnWVpE
transaction
528186ae7a2566f32542ed9473d44ad168d2791574214330dcdc3aa9beee11c0